
《富甲天下5》的主公人數由7位提高至21位,全新的寵物系統、玩家可自由分配升級點數和學習技能 ,全新3vs3將戰系統,還有更多的武器裝備及兩百多位武將等你來募集!搜集資源率先打造出經典建築也能贏得勝利!參考玩家意見,展現更流暢爽快的《富甲天下5》STEAM版!支援一台電腦四人同樂!

Richman 5 is a strategy board game hybrid developed and published by T-Time Technology CO., LTD. that combines competitive board game mechanics with character progression, resource management, and light tactical systems. Rather than focusing exclusively on traditional economic gameplay or deep strategy simulation, the game blends multiple genres together into a format designed to create both accessibility and replayability. The result is an experience that balances luck, planning, and progression systems while maintaining the social energy often associated with digital board game experiences. The core structure revolves around players competing across large game boards where movement, property acquisition, resource collection, and long-term planning determine success. At first glance, the formula feels familiar to players experienced with party board games. Rolling movement values, managing finances, and controlling territory remain central elements of progression. However, Richman 5 gradually expands beyond those fundamentals by layering role-playing mechanics and strategic customization systems that give players additional control over how matches develop. One of the game's strongest qualities comes from its progression systems. Characters improve over time through experience accumulation and growth mechanics that create a greater sense of long-term investment. Instead of relying entirely on chance, players can influence future performance by developing abilities and strengthening their chosen leaders. Character progression introduces strategic decision-making that complements board movement rather than replacing it, creating a satisfying balance between randomness and preparation. The roster of available characters adds further variety to the experience. Different leaders create opportunities for experimentation while helping matches remain fresh across repeated sessions. Choosing a preferred character becomes more meaningful because progression systems allow players to shape development around different approaches and priorities. The larger selection also contributes positively to replay value by encouraging players to explore alternative strategies. Role-playing elements extend beyond simple statistics. Skill growth and customization mechanics strengthen player ownership over progression while helping individual matches feel more personal. Rather than simply reacting to events on the board, players gradually build stronger characters capable of influencing future situations more effectively. These additions help Richman 5 stand apart from simpler board game adaptations that rely entirely on movement and resource collection. Combat systems introduce another layer of engagement throughout progression. Tactical encounters shift gameplay away from purely board-focused competition and create moments where preparation and character development directly influence outcomes. Unit management and equipment systems expand strategic possibilities while giving collected resources additional importance beyond financial value alone. These mechanics create welcome pacing variation and strengthen the overall progression loop. Equipment acquisition and officer recruitment contribute further depth. Players gain opportunities to strengthen their position through multiple progression avenues rather than relying solely on property ownership or resource accumulation. This variety helps prevent matches from becoming repetitive while encouraging adaptation based on circumstances that emerge during competition. The addition of companion mechanics provides another enjoyable feature that supports customization. Additional systems surrounding support characters create further opportunities for strategic experimentation while helping progression remain rewarding across longer sessions. These mechanics may appear secondary initially, but they gradually contribute to a stronger overall gameplay identity. Multiplayer remains one of Richman 5's most appealing strengths. Board game-inspired experiences naturally benefit from social interaction, and direct competition against other players helps create memorable moments filled with unpredictability and tension. The structure supports entertaining rivalries while preserving enough randomness to ensure matches rarely unfold identically. Visually, the game favors colorful presentation and readable design over technical ambition. Character models and environments complement the lighter tone while maintaining clarity during gameplay. Menus remain approachable, and information stays accessible without overwhelming newer players. The visual presentation supports functionality effectively while maintaining a style appropriate for the game's broader audience. Its hybrid approach naturally creates limitations alongside strengths. Players searching for highly advanced tactical systems may find certain mechanics simplified compared to dedicated strategy titles. Likewise, players hoping for pure board game simplicity may find progression systems more involved than expected. However, Richman 5 succeeds precisely because it attempts to occupy space between those genres rather than committing entirely to one design philosophy. The pacing generally remains engaging due to the constant mixture of movement decisions, progression systems, tactical encounters, and competitive board management. There is enough variety to sustain interest without making systems overly complicated. Long-term growth mechanics help strengthen replay value while giving players meaningful goals beyond simply winning individual matches. Richman 5 succeeds by combining multiple gameplay styles into a cohesive experience built around strategy, competition, and progression. T-Time Technology CO., LTD. creates a game that preserves the entertaining unpredictability of board game design while strengthening it through customization and tactical variety. The result delivers an enjoyable balance of social competition and strategic planning that remains appealing even years after release. For players who enjoy board game structure combined with progression systems and strategic decision-making, Richman 5 offers an entertaining blend of ideas that creates both casual enjoyment and deeper long-term engagement.
